How to Watch the UEFA Women's Euro 2025 Final: England vs. Spain

This Sunday, all eyes will be on St. Jakob-Park as defending champions England face off against the 2023 World Cup winners Spain in the highly anticipated Women's Euro 2025 Final. Kickoff is scheduled for 6 p.m. CEST, which translates to 12 p.m. ET in the US and Canada, 5 p.m. BST in the UK, and 2 a.m. AEST in Australia. Match Overview

Spain has dominated the Euro 2025 tournament, showcasing their prowess by scoring 14 goals across three group matches against Portugal, Belgium, and Italy, and successfully advancing past Switzerland and Germany in the knockout rounds. On the other hand, England, led by coach Sarina Wiegman, is making their fifth consecutive appearance in a major tournament final, having achieved thrilling comebacks against Sweden and Italy in the knockout stages.

While Spain appears to have a fully fit squad, England fans are concerned about the fitness of key forward Lauren James, who was substituted at half-time during the semi-final. As the teams prepare for their showdown, the excitement continues to build among soccer fans globally.

Live Streaming Options for the UEFA Women's Euro 2025 Final

United States

Fans in the US can catch the final live on Fox. If you don’t have Fox in your cable package, consider streaming services like Sling TV and Fubo. With Sling TV's Blue plan, you can access Fox and FS1 for just $23 for the first month, compared to the usual $46. Alternatively, Fubo's Pro Plan, priced at $85 a month, offers 121 channels, including Fox and FS1 for an extensive viewing experience.

United Kingdom

UK viewers are in luck as they can watch the match for free on both ITV1 and BBC1. ITV1's coverage starts at 3:30 p.m. BST, while BBC1 kicks off at 3:40 p.m. BST. You can stream the match online via ITVX and BBC iPlayer without any cost, provided you have a valid UK TV license.

Canada

In Canada, soccer enthusiasts can watch the final on TSN, with the option to stream through TSN Plus, which is available for CA$20 a month or CA$200 annually. TSN offers a range of sports coverage, making it a great choice for cord-cutters wanting to stay updated on international soccer.

Australia

Australian fans can enjoy the final through Optus Sport, which provides dedicated coverage of various international soccer events. If you are an Optus network subscriber, you can access Optus Sport for AU$10 a month, while standalone subscriptions start at AU$25 a month.
